The year 2015 is considered as a thrilling one for some Ghanaian artists as well as Ghanaian music. Many artists soared both nationally and internationally raising high the flag of their homeland Ghana.

One of the acts, who stood tall amongst his companions last year is dancehall artist, Livingstone Etse Satekla, commonly known as Stonebwoy in the music industry.

The dancehall artist made an immense effect in the Ghanaian music industry in 2015.

The following are some of the high points of his music career a year ago:

Stonebwoy practically had nominations in all the significant award ceremonies held in 2015 and even went ahead to bag most of the awards.

He won the highest award, ‘Artist of the Year’ at the Vodafone Ghana Music Awards 2015 (VGMAs). He likewise won two other awards at the same event, ‘Reggae/Dancehall Artiste of the Year’ and ‘Reggae/Dancehall Song of the Year’.

In that same year, Stonebwoy beat Sarkodie, AKA, Yemi Alade and WizKid to win the ‘Best International Act – Africa’ at the BET Awards 2015.

Still on awards, Stonebwoy won six awards out of eight nominations at the 2015 BASS Awards. The awards incorporated the Artiste of the Year at the event.

Once more, at the 4Syte Music Video Awards, he won ‘The Most Influential Artist of the Year’, ‘Best Directed Video’ and ‘Best Reggae/Dancehall’.

In July, he was at in South Africa, where he had a nomination in the Best New Act category. Despite the fact that he didn’t win, Stonebwoy gave a noteworthy performance on the night.

Far from all the major and minor awards, Stonebwoy performed at all significant shows in the last year.

His ‘Go Higher’ tour saw him perform, close by some of Ghana’s finest, at packed shows in the capital, Accra and Tamale.

In May 2015, he organized ‘A definitive Concert’ to thank his fans for supporting his music and his BHIM Nation group alive and solid.

In November, Stonebwoy performed at the ‘Mo Ibrahim’ show with some top African music acts, for example, Angélique Kidjo, Youssou N’Dour and Sarkodie.

Outside the capital Accra, he featured the Akwambo Muzik Festival at Swedru in August where he excited fans by thrilling performances.

In Koforidua, in the Eastern Region, he was one of A-list artists at the ‘Celebrity Soccer Weekend’ where he played football furthermore performed for his fans. That event was followed by the ‘Tigo Unplugged’ show in Kumasi.

One of the main highlights of Stonebwoy’s 2015 timetable was in November when he joined Jamaican fabulous reggae group ‘Morgan Heritage’. He joined the group as one of the main artists for their European visit named “Strictly Root”.

The visit witness Stonebwoy perform in Tivolivredenburg Utrecht, Metropole Hall Lausanne, Switzerland and at De Vaartkapoen Bruxelles Brussel, Belgium

Amid the year, he worked Jamaican acts, Kranium and I Octane, Nigeria’s Patoranking and Burna Boy, and Ghanaian famous acts, R2Bees, Yaa Pono and a host of others.
